dc.description.abstractUnderstanding entity is important to solve many entity-related problems such as information retrieval, recommendation, and question answering. To help machines understand entities, knowledge bases have been constructed. However, these knowledge bases suffer from the incomplete problem. To solve this incomplete problem, we extract and add three interesting relationship types: 1) social, 2) comparable, and 3) verb relationships. For each relationship type, we propose a solution to extract relationships from external resource by utilizing knowledge bases. We also show their effectiveness empirically.-
